C之缘


私信TA

用户名:zhangsenself

访问量:2901

签 名:

没有最好,只有更好,成功就是专心地将一件事做到极致!

等  级
排  名 30866
经  验 446
参赛次数 0
文章发表 3
年  龄 0
在职情况 学生
学  校 常州大学
专  业 电子信息工程

  自我简介:

解题思路:
    由题目可知,需要将成绩分为五个等级A,B,C,D,E,采用if..else if..else..实现,也可采用switch来实现。
注意事项:

    使用if...else if...else..为了严谨,需要加一个0~100的判断,if((x>=0)&&(x<=100))
参考代码:

#include <stdio.h>

int main()

{

    int x;

    scanf("%d",&x);

    if((x>=0)&&(x<=100))

    {

        if(x>=90)

            printf("A\n");

            else if((x>=80)&&(x<90))

                printf("B\n");

                else if((x>=70)&&(x<80))

                    printf("C\n");

                    else if((x>=60)&&(x<70))

                        printf("D\n");

                        else

                            printf("E\n");

    }

    return 0;

}


 

0.0分

0 人评分

看不懂代码?想转换其他语言的代码? 或者想问其他问题? 试试问问AI编程助手,随时响应你的问题:

编程语言转换

万能编程问答

代码解释器

  评论区